Why do INFJ men always feel invisible? This is a question that so many INFJ men ask themselves and there are no easy answers. This is a very specific problem that causes a lot of confusion for men with an INFJ personality type. They feel invisible because they feel like they are not seen at parties/group gatherings, they are not listened to in work meetings, and they are routinely ignored in relationships. Most INFJ men grew up in situations where it was safer to stay invisible, which means that at an early age they subconsciously turned on the “invisibility cloak,” and they suppressed their natural personality by not talking very much, not asking questions, adopting withdrawn body language, and not making waves in relationships, or in the household. Women with the INFJ personality type tend to do this too, but INFJ men suffer more from it because of the way masculinity is viewed in our culture. Since masculinity is supposed to be aggressive, outgoing, take-charge, and commanding, the way that INFJ men work their energy is the opposite of what most people expect from men, and because INFJ men with invisibility cloak subconsciously turned on are working their energy in an opposite way, they are more ignored than INFJ women (who are “supposed to be” more withdrawn and submissive). There is a solution to this, and numerous strategies that INFJ men can use to shift out of this ongoing state of invisibility and make their voices be heard.
